>> diff --git a/sysdeps/unix/sysv/linux/loongarch/gettimeofday.c b/sysdeps/unix/sysv/linux/loongarch/gettimeofday.c
>> index 93ea6ce445..b084d52769 100644
>> --- a/sysdeps/unix/sysv/linux/loongarch/gettimeofday.c
>> +++ b/sysdeps/unix/sysv/linux/loongarch/gettimeofday.c
>> @@ -17,6 +17,9 @@
>> License along with the GNU C Library. If not, see
>> <https://www.gnu.org/licenses/>. */
>>
>> -
>> -#define USE_IFUNC_GETTIMEOFDAY
>> -#include <sysdeps/unix/sysv/linux/gettimeofday.c>
>> +#ifdef __loongarch64
>> + #define USE_IFUNC_GETTIMEOFDAY
>> + #include <sysdeps/unix/sysv/linux/gettimeofday.c>
>> +# else
>> + #include <sysdeps/unix/sysv/linux/gettimeofday.c>
>> +#endif
> Wouldn't be simpler to just:
>
> #ifdef __loongarch
> # define USE_IFUNC_GETTIMEOFDAY
> #endif
> #include <sysdeps/unix/sysv/linux/gettimeofday.c>
>
> Does it meant that loongarch32 does not have ifunc support?
According to "sysdeps/unix/sysv/linux/gettimeofday.c",
it seems to use __gettimeofday if define USE_IFUNC_GETTIMEOFDAY,
But LA32 need to use __gettimeofday64.
